Hansens Gamle Familiehave is a beloved Danish restaurant nestled beside the leafy pathways of Frederiksberg Gardens. Open since 1850, it’s renowned for generous portions, heartfelt hospitality, and a nostalgic ambiance evocative of Copenhagen’s golden age. Visitors step through garden gates to discover a lively oasis hosting traditional smørrebrød, hearty Danish classics, and vibrant summer festivities under string lights and spreading chestnut trees—a local institution for multigenerational gatherings and authentic Danish flavor.

Local tips

  • Book a table in advance, especially in spring and summer, when the garden terrace becomes one of Copenhagen’s most coveted dining spots.
  • Don’t miss the traditional Danish open-faced sandwiches—smørrebrød—and save room for homemade cakes if you arrive for afternoon coffee.
  • For a uniquely festive experience, plan a visit during weekends or holidays when live music and group singing sessions are often part of the program.
  • Families are warmly welcomed, with a dedicated play area and a menu adapted for younger guests.
  • If visiting by car, be aware that parking nearby can be limited; consider public transport or walking if possible, especially on sunny days.

Discover more about Hansens Gamle Familiehave

Step into the enchanting world of Hansens Gamle Familiehave, an icon of Frederiksberg deeply intertwined with the cultural identity of Copenhagen. Established in 1850, this historic Danish restaurant invites guests to experience a slice of living history, where the cheerful hum of families mingles with the scent of crisp schnitzel and sweet summer blooms. The garden setting, draped in climbing vines and strewn with lanterns, calls forth scenes of old Copenhagen, when outdoor dining among chestnut trees was the height of conviviality. Within the cheerful, wood-paneled interiors, classic Danish cuisine is lovingly prepared: generous platters of smørrebrød, roasted meats, creamy potatoes, and time-honored desserts find their way to tables as laughter echoes across generations. Throughout summer, the atmosphere swells with joy as live music, group singing, and traditional celebrations turn ordinary meals into memorable gatherings. On warm afternoons, elderly couples linger over coffee while children play within sight of Denmark’s past—captured in creaky floorboards and antique garden benches. Hansens Gamle Familiehave’s enduring appeal lies in its heartfelt service and commitment to tradition. Whether visiting for a casual lunch, a jubilant birthday, or spring’s first outdoor feast, every guest is embraced like family. Vegetarians and younger diners are thoughtfully accommodated, but it’s the robust, classic fare and the semi-secret “garden songs” that truly unite guests in shared revelry. Few places in Copenhagen so deftly blend authenticity, history, and sheer joy: Hansens is a living celebration of Danish togetherness, firmly rooted in the city’s greenest, most storied corner.
